The explanation is shown below:
1. You have that the total number of vertical feet that a climber has traveled (which you can call [tex]y[/tex]), varies directly with the number of hours she has been climbing (which you can call [tex]x[/tex]), and the constant of proportionality is 600 ([tex]k=600[/tex]).
2. Keeping this on mind you can express it as following:
[tex]y=kx\\y=600x[/tex]
3. Now, substitute the values given in the table and solve for [tex]y[/tex] to calculate the number of feet or solve for [tex]x[/tex] to calculate the time in hours:
a) [tex]y=(600)(\frac{1}{2})=300[/tex]
b) [tex]y=(600)(1)=600[/tex]
c) [tex]x=\frac{1}{600}=1.66*10^{-3}[/tex]
d) [tex]x=\frac{2}{600}=3.33*10^{-3}[/tex]
e) [tex]y = (600)(4)=2400[/tex]
